Why Folic Acid and B12 are often Recommended Together

Folic acid (vitamin B9) and vitamin B12 are both B-vitamins that are crucial for numerous bodily functions. A metabolic pathway known as the one-carbon metabolism relies on the synergy between B12 and folate. One of their primary combined roles is the metabolism of homocysteine, an amino acid. Both deficiencies can lead to megaloblastic anemia, where the body produces unusually large, inefficient red blood cells.

The Synergy in Action

The partnership between these two vitamins is vital for cellular health. Folic acid needs B12 to function properly, particularly in the process of DNA synthesis and replication. A deficit in B12 can trap folate in an unusable form, a phenomenon known as the 'methyl trap'. This metabolic link is why doctors often check B12 levels before prescribing high-dose folic acid to prevent the progression of underlying B12 deficiency-related neurological damage.

Critical Functions Supported by Both Vitamins

  • Red Blood Cell Production: Both are essential for the formation of healthy red blood cells that transport oxygen throughout the body.
  • Nervous System Health: They are fundamental for maintaining the myelin sheath that protects nerves and for promoting proper brain function.
  • Homocysteine Reduction: Combined supplementation has been shown to reduce homocysteine levels in the blood, which is beneficial for cardiovascular health.
  • Cognitive Function: Research indicates that taking these two vitamins can improve cognitive performance in older adults with mild cognitive impairment.

Potential Risks and Precautions

While the combination is generally safe, it's not without risks. The primary concern is that high doses of folic acid can correct the anemia associated with a vitamin B12 deficiency, but do so without addressing the underlying B12 issue. This can cause the B12 deficiency to progress silently, leading to potentially irreversible neurological damage. Therefore, medical supervision is critical, especially for at-risk groups.

A Deeper Look into the 'Masking' Effect

Before the late 1990s, when folic acid fortification became widespread, the megaloblastic anemia caused by a B12 deficiency often served as a clear warning sign. Doctors would treat the B12 deficiency directly. However, with ubiquitous folic acid in fortified foods, people with a hidden B12 deficiency may not show the anemic symptoms, allowing the neurological damage to advance unnoticed. This is why testing B12 levels is a standard precaution before beginning high-dose folic acid therapy.

Comparison: Folic Acid vs. Folate

Understanding the difference between synthetic folic acid and naturally occurring folate is important for supplement users. Folic Acid Folate
Origin Synthetic, man-made form of vitamin B9. Naturally occurring form of vitamin B9 found in food.
Absorption More easily absorbed by the body (approximately 85% absorption). Less bioavailable; absorption is more complex.
Availability Used in dietary supplements and fortified foods. Found in natural food sources like leafy greens, beans, and oranges.
Metabolism Requires conversion in the liver, which can lead to unmetabolized folic acid in the bloodstream at high doses. Metabolized directly by the body.
Risk Factor High intake can mask a B12 deficiency. Natural intake does not pose the same masking risk.

Who Should Take a Folic Acid and B12 Combination?

The combination is particularly beneficial for several populations, provided it is done under medical guidance:

  • Pregnant or Planning Pregnancy: Supplementation with folic acid and B12 is essential before and during pregnancy to prevent neural tube defects and support fetal development.
  • Older Adults: As absorption of B12 decreases with age, older adults are at higher risk for deficiency and associated cognitive issues.
  • Vegans and Vegetarians: Since B12 is primarily found in animal products, plant-based diets necessitate supplementation to avoid deficiency.
  • Individuals with Digestive Disorders: People with conditions like celiac disease or Crohn's may have impaired nutrient absorption and require higher doses.
  • Those with High Homocysteine Levels: Individuals with elevated homocysteine are often recommended this combination to help lower levels and reduce cardiovascular risk.
